"We discussed security guarantees and investments in drone production" - Zelensky
![]()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ky and British Prime Minister Keir Starmer discussed the topic of security guarantees. Zelensky reported this. “We discussed in detail security guarantees that can make the world truly stable if the United States can force Russia to stop the killings and switch to substantive diplomacy. It is important that we, within the framework of the “coalition of the willing,” can jointly achieve effective formats for work in the security sphere,” Zelensky wrote. “A separate and important item on the agenda was investments in the production of unmanned aerial vehicles. We have significant potential to increase production volumes, and this requires immediate financing. UAVs play an important role on the front line. Ukraine’s capabilities for their production are unique, so investments in this production can really affect the situation at the strategic level,” the Ukrainian President added. |
